video art "Surviving the Purple Prophecyy" and photo cycle "The art of Surviving One Day on Planet Earth in 2017".
"Surviving the Purple Prophecy" depicts the invasion of a superior military power in Europe through a series of impressions shot in Gdansk, Bergamo and Milan. The scenes look like frozen artifacts of images captured via surveillance cameras, providing a haunting insight into the loss of control. This video art shows the silent side of fear, uncertainty and paralysis.
